Mahabaleshwar
Colonial-era hill station of valley viewpoints and strawberry farms.
Panchgani & Table Land
Hilltop plateau and lookout beside Mahabaleshwar.
Pratapgad Fort
Historic Shivaji-era fort on a Sahyadri ridge near Mahabaleshwar.
Venna Lake
Boating lake at the centre of Mahabaleshwar.
Arthur’s Seat
Cliff viewpoint over the Konkan valley below.
Kaas Plateau
UNESCO valley-of-flowers plateau that blooms after the monsoon.
Thoseghar Falls
Dramatic monsoon waterfalls on the Sahyadri edge.
Sajjangad Fort
Hill fort and samadhi of the saint Ramdas.
Ajinkyatara Fort
Hill fort overlooking Satara city.
